History

Black Sea fleet.

Torpedoed and sunk by the Italian torpedo boat MAS-571 near Cape Ai-Todor while performing transport duties to Sevastopol. 38 men lost, 2 men survived.

Noteable events involving ShCh-214 include:


3 Nov 1941
ShCh-214 sinks the Turkish sailing vessel Kaynakdere (85 GRT) with gunfire south-east of Cape Igneada, Turkey in position 41º45'N, 28º16'E. (see map)

4 Nov 1941
ShCh-214 fires a torpedo against ' what is identified as ' a merchant of 4000 GRT off Cape Servi, Turkey. The torpedo however missed it's target.

5 Nov 1941
ShCh-214 torpedoes and sinks the Italian tanker Torcello (3336 GRT) east of Cape Igneada, Turkey in position 41º53'N, 28º22'E. (see map)

1 Jan 1942
ShCh-214 sinks the Turkish sailing vessel Koraltepe (209 GRT) with gunfire east of Cape Igneada, Turkey in position 41º43'N, 28º15'E. (see map)

29 May 1942
ShCh-214 sinks the Turkish sailing vessel Hudavendigar (90 GRT) through ramming east-south-east of Cape Igneada, Turkey in position 41º50'N, 28º14'E (see map)

31 May 1942
ShCh-214 sinks the Turkish sailing vessel Mahbubdihan (85 GRT) with gunfire east-north-east of Cape Igneada, Turkey in position 41º55'N, 28º15'E (see map)

2 Jun 1942
ShCh-214 sinks the Turkish sailing vessel Kaynarea through ramming east of Rezovo, Bulgaria (on the Bulgian-Turkish border) in position 42º00'N, 28º16'E (see map)
